Atlanta should not be selected simply because it is geographically closer on a map. Physical distance is only one part of network performance. ISP routing, peering, network paths and the location of individual users can affect latency and packet loss.
If testing shows better routes from another U.S. location to your most important users, that location may be the better choice. Businesses serving users across different regions can also consider a multi-location deployment rather than relying on a single server location.

Network performance should be evaluated against the users, offices and services that matter to your workload. TheServerHost provides Atlanta connectivity options and network testing information so you can review real network paths before deployment.
✓ Check round-trip latency using an Atlanta Test IP from the networks that will access your server.
✓ Review the network path with traceroute to see how traffic travels between your location and Atlanta.
✓ Examine route stability with MTR to identify latency changes or packet loss along the path.
✓ Test relevant ISPs used by your customers, offices or remote teams instead of relying on a single test location.
✓ Compare multiple locations when your application serves users across different geographic regions.
Important: Real-world route testing is more useful than relying on a generic latency claim. Results can vary by ISP, destination and network path.

RAID Note: RAID can improve storage availability or performance depending on the selected RAID level and drive layout, but it should not be treated as an independent backup. Important data should also be protected through a separate backup and recovery plan.

Planning Point: Decide not only what needs to be backed up, but also how much recent data your business could afford to lose and how quickly the workload would need to be restored after an interruption. These requirements help determine backup frequency, retention and recovery planning.
Moving an existing workload to Atlanta involves more than transferring files. TheServerHost can assist with planning the deployment, preparing the new environment and supporting the server after launch according to the selected service level. As requirements change, the deployment can also be reviewed for resource upgrades or expansion beyond a single server.
A planned migration helps reduce unexpected problems during the production cutover.
✓ Review current CPU, memory, storage and network usage
✓ Identify operating-system and software requirements
✓ Check application and database dependencies
✓ Estimate the amount of data that needs to be transferred
✓ Identify required IP addresses, ports and external services
✓ Plan DNS changes, migration timing and an appropriate rollback path
✓ Prepare the new Atlanta server
✓ Configure the required operating system and software environment
✓ Transfer websites, applications, databases or hosting accounts
✓ Test applications and database connectivity before changing production traffic
✓ Complete DNS or service cutover
✓ Verify external access and application availability after migration

Not necessarily. IP geolocation databases are maintained by third parties and may update their records at different times. An IP assigned to your Atlanta server may temporarily appear under another city or nearby location in some databases. The database operator controls how the address is displayed.
